Applications are open for the British Council ColabNowNow 2019 The British Council welcomes young digital creatives to participate in the 3rd edition of ColabNowNow in collaboration with Maputo Quick Forward and Fak’ ugesi African Digital Development Festivals.

ColabNowNow will choose 11 digital artists from Africa and the UK to establish cutting edge digital art work through collective artmaking and storytelling. Candidates will use with suggested jobs which will then be established with creative and technical facilitators. Together they will develop a collective exhibit to be released on 11 October 2019 at the opening of the Maputo Quick Forward celebration.

Program Information

Picked creatives will satisfy in Johannesburg at the Fak’ ugesi African Digital Development Celebration (3-8 September) where they will share their imaginative deal with each other and the general public through workshops and discussions. Nowadays will set the foundation for the collective work over the next month, where a creative and a technical facilitator will engage with the creatives online to establish the work from 9– 31 September. (Facilitators have actually been chosen from a closed call consisting of ColabNowNow creatives from 2017 and 2018).

Creatives will then satisfy in Maputo, Mozambique, 2-12 October, to work collaboratively in the lead approximately the opening of the ColabNowNow exhibit which accompanies the opening of the Maputo Quick Forward Celebration. The exhibit will be catalogued and digitised, permitting it to take a trip from November 2019– February 2020 to East, West and North Africa, THE UK, and in its totality online.

Advantages

  • Creatives will get creative and technical assistance from 2 facilitators, who will deal with the creatives to establish complicated collective operate in both their conceptual and technical types
  • All travel, lodging, meals and VISA expenses are covered by the British Council
  • Artists will be paid a charge of 500 GBP for their involvement
  • A technical and setup budget plan is readily available for the cumulative usage of the ColabNowNow group

Eligibility

  • Open to artists and writers operating in digital media who are aged 18-35
  • You need to reside in and have a legitimate passport from among the qualified nations
  • You need to be readily available to take a trip to Johannesburg 3-8 September, and Maputo 2-12 October– consisting of travel time prior to and after stated dates. Complete participation is needed
  • Previous chosen ColabNowNow creatives are not qualified to use.

Choice Process

Applications for ColabNowNow go through a stringent and confidential blind-jury procedure where gender and nation balance are turned into the shortlisting procedure. Candidates will be evaluated exclusively on their creative propositions and their capability to work collaboratively with others in order to establish brand-new work from their proposition.

The jury will be comprised of agents from Fak’ ugesi African Digital Development Celebration, Maputo Quick Forward, British Council (UK, EastAfricaArts, SouthernAfricaArts, WestAfricaArts), and the creative and technical facilitators.
